The ingredients needed to make Talipia With Orange, Avocado, Onions, Yellow Peppers And Jalepenos:
  1. Get 1 Talipia Filet
  2. Make ready 2 small onions
  3. Take 1 Yellow Pepper
  4. Make ready 1 Avocado
  5. Take 8 Jalepeño Slices
  6. Get 2 tbsp extra Virgin Olive Oli

Steps to make Talipia With Orange, Avocado, Onions, Yellow Peppers And Jalepenos:
  1. Sautee chopped onions and yellow pepper in olive oil until tender. Set aside.
  2. Peel avocado and cut into small cubes. Set aside.
  3. Cut jalepenos into small pieces. Set aside.
  4. Peel orange and cut it into small pieces. Set aside.
  5. Pan grill talipia filet in same skillet used to sautéed. Add orange pieces to same pan. while cooking.
  6. Add part of the onions and peppers back into the skillet.
  7. Cook filet on medium heat until done. Approximately 10-15 minutes.
  8. Serve filet on plate, and top with orange, onion, peppers, adding acovado and jalepenos to taste.
  9. Serve your favorite green veggie. I used steamed Brussel sprouts.
  10. I made banana cinnamon bread in my bread maker and served thick slices with butter.
